Part 1—Preliminary

1—Short title

These regulations may be cited as the State Procurement Variation Regulations 2006.

2—Commencement

These regulations come into operation on the day on which they are made.

3—Variation provisions

In these regulations, a provision under a heading referring to the variation of specified regulations varies the regulations so specified.

Part 2—Variation of State Procurement Regulations 2005

4—Variation of regulation 4—Bodies declared to be prescribed public authorities (section 4 of Act)

  1. Regulation 4—before "Local Government Finance Authority" insert:

    Land Management Corporation

  2. Regulation 4—after "Local Government Superannuation Board" insert:

    Motor Accident Commission

    South Australian Centre for Trauma and Injury Recovery Incorporated

  3. Regulation 4—after "TransAdelaide" insert:

    WorkCover Corporation of South Australia

Note—

As required by section 10AA(2) of the Subordinate Legislation Act 1978, the Minister has certified that, in the Minister's opinion, it is necessary or appropriate that these regulations come into operation as set out in these regulations.
